    Question Asking opinion about a 35SS Nicodem List

    Hello,

    After a long time reading some posts about the rezzers, checking the Malifaux wiki and different other sites I finally decided to begin next month my rezzers crew.

    Juggling with different masters I decided to start with Nicodem as my first leader. Later on i'll perhaps add Kirai (couldn't get y eyes off Mako's thread in the miniature showcase ) , but that's not for the next few monthes.

    Well, here's, in my opinion, a balanced list and I wanted to know what you think about. Although I've never played Malifaux i''ve already played different other tabletop games since nearly twelve years now:

    Master:
    • Nicodem, the Undertaker
    Minions:
    • Mortimer, the Gravedigger
    • Bęte Noire
    • 3 Canine remains
    • 2 Punk Zombies
    Totem
    • 1 Vulture
    In addition I wanted to buy 1 Flesh contruct and two packs of mindless zombies.
    With my precedented boughts this would give me 6 Mindless Zombies, 1 Flesh construct, 1 Punk Zombie and 1 canine remain to summon during the game.

    The goal was to make a list which isn't expensive in terms of buying supplies (more or less 70 € / 85$) and, as I already told can complete different strategies.

    Welcome to the rotting hoard. While Nicodem isn't among my list of played masters I do have one theory that I think could be useful, when playing and building your list think of him as if you were playing a version of Kirai. What I mean by that is that Kirai often has a very set number of models that go into her crew to augment her survivability and summoning, and I'd look at Nicodem the same way. Your posted list above goes a good way towards utilizing that Ideal.

    I feel it is beneficial to figure out how many mindless zombies you want to have around Nicodem from the beginning of the game and do your best to have them on the first turn, as you will very rarely ever want to use arise over bolster in the later turns of the game. Bringing some cheap models to burn activations on and then slaughter and raise them as targets for Zombie fodder, attackers, and Nicodem blockers is very beneficial. In addition now you have the resources at hand to summon what ever is most effective at the proper time. That block will be a pain to shift, and would be very effective at anything goal that will require you to hold something if you need to.

    Another thing to think about, and I'd be interested to hear what rancor has to say about this topic, is that I feel that Nicodem is one of those masters that really wants to activate early in the round, almost exclusively. He wants to get his Bolster up super quick so that more models will benefit from it longer. He wants to start tossing off his rigor Mortis to prevent you from acting this turn, and to decay to heal his troops, and dmg yours. Even if he is never successful because you cheat to prevent everything he is doing that's awesome too, as Nicodem really shines as crew support, and draining your hand in preparation for when the Cb 9 paired Punk zombie walks up to let you closely examine his katana is almost as good as getting the dmg through.

    I'd also agree with Rancor that the GS might be better, although like him I can see the potential in using with Bete Noir, in addition even if it is insignificant, a model with a 10" move for so cheap is certainly of use in certain situations.

    Hey, welcome to rezzers! Nicodem is one of my favorite masters as well.

    One quick reminder, you play to strategy and your opponent's faction--especially with Nicodem. This means that you'll actually get to use a wider variety of models you buy! With the list you presented, you really want to replace a dog with a Vulture, otherwise--as others have said--it's a good starting point. You'll want a Rogue Necromancy and possibly another Flesh Construct for summoning purposes pretty quickly.

    Other things to try as time allows:

    - Grave Spirit
    Makes Nicodem more survivable. If your opponent calls Neverborn just assume Chompybits and either get this or make a shell of swarming models (Canine Remains or Necropunks, usually).

    - Dead Rider
    Combined with the above, it takes Nicodem from being one of the slowest masters in the game to being able to cast spells into your opponent's deployment zone turn one. It's a very different way of playing Nicodem.

    - Seamus Box
    It's a classic and it remains good--the ol' pull and stab. It's great for things like Claim Jump or Slaughter. You get it for the Belles, mostly.

    - Necropunks
    You need objective runners eventually. Dogs only get you so far.

    - Killjoy
    Combine with the above. It's really fun. ^_^

    - Datsu-Ba
    Possibly when you purchase Kirai's box. She's good for Turf War, Reconnoiter, Etc. Keep killing Mindless Zombies for Gaki/Onryo to build up model count.
